Backscatter
Type: Retailer, manufacturer, education Founded: 1994 (Monterey, California, USA) Key products: Mini Flash, Optical Snoot; retail of all major UW photo brands
Overview
Backscatter was founded in 1994 by Berkley White on Cannery Row in Monterey, California. It grew to become the largest underwater imaging retailer in the world, with east and west coast locations. The company serves as the official warranty repair center for most major underwater photography brands.
Beyond retail, Backscatter produces original content (reviews, tutorials, video comparisons), hosts 100+ instructional events, classes, and photo safaris annually, and develops their own products including the Mini Flash and Optical Snoot.
Product timeline
- 1994: Founded by Berkley White on Cannery Row, Monterey
- 2002: Showed MacroMate lens at DEMA 2002; Sea & Sea and Nexus dealer ([1], [2])
- 2003: Sold Sea & Sea, Subal, Nexus products; introduced Athena glass dome ports at DEMA 2003 ([3], [4], [5])
- 2004: Digital Shootout Fiji 2004 sponsor; carried Hartenberger strobes, MacroMate diopters, TopDawg brand ([6], [7])
- 2005: Digital Shootout Bonaire 2005 sponsor; MacroMate diopter maker ([8])
- 2005-06: Neutral density (ND) underwater filter system in development ([9])
- 2012-10: Appointed as Olympus distributor — becomes official Olympus UW sales channel. ([10])
- 2014-04: MacroMate Mini diopter launched. ([11])
- 2013-03: Releases the AirLock vacuum integrity check system. ([12])
- 2011-11: Releases Wahoo HD monitor housing. ([13])
- 2013-08: Expands Flip filter family for GoPro and compact cameras. ([14])
- 2012-05: Announces filter solution for GoPro. ([15])
- 2018-07: Ships TG-5 wide angle conversion lens — proprietary optic for Olympus Tough series. ([16])
- 2019-03: Ships wide angle lens for Olympus TG series cameras. ([17])
- 2019-11: MF-1 Mini Flash ($399) and OS-1 Optical Snoot ($149) announced at DEMA 2019. Designed for macro shooters, powered by single Nitecore 18650 cell, integral focus light. Combo pack $499. Ships December. Created a new category of compact, affordable strobe/snoot systems. ([18])
- 2020-02: MF-1 Mini Flash and OS-1 reviewed by Mike Bartick. ([19])
- 2020-11: Macro Wide 4300 video light announced — 4300 lumens, 85° beam angle, macro mode with 1400-lumen spot, compatible with existing OS-1 snoot. Introductory $399. ([20])
- 2021-10: MF-1 Mini Flash and OS-1 reviewed by Morten Bjorn Larsen on Wetpixel. ([21])
- 2022-11: Mini Flash 2 (MF-2) announced — major upgrade with optical TTL (Olympus), high speed sync, wireless control, compatible with existing snoots. $399. Mid-November delivery. ([22])
